Dudson Staffordshire titled swan & cygnet spill vase
Victorian, circa 1860. 4.7ins high, 5.5ins wide, 3.2ins depth. Dudson Staffordshire spill vase which features two swans and two cygnets, seated on a shaped base. The piece is titled, 'A present from Scarborough' . Lilac extruded clay version. Dull gilt title and embellishment.
Decorated mainly to the front.
Book reference,'Victorian Staffordshire Figures 1835-1875' Book 3, by A.& N. Harding, page 258, figure a2832A.
Condition
Good. No restoration.
A few paint losses to the left swan's beak.
Slight rubbing to gilt.
KILN EFFECTS: shrinkage crack to the spill interior;
shrinkage line to the underside;
touch mark with associated chip to the side of the base.
